    [PATCH] Require mmap handler for a.out executables

    Files supported by fs/proc/base.c, i.e. /proc/<pid>/*, are not capable
    of meeting the validity checks in ELF load_elf_*() handling because they
    have no mmap handler which is required by ELF. In order to stop a.out
    executables being used as part of an exploit attack against /proc-related
    vulnerabilities, we make a.out executables depend on ->mmap() existing.

    Signed-off-by: Eugene Teo <eteo@redhat.com>
    Signed-off-by: Marcel Holtmann <marcel@holtmann.org>

    diff --git a/fs/binfmt_aout.c b/fs/binfmt_aout.c
    index f312103..2042dfa 100644
    --- a/fs/binfmt_aout.c
    +++ b/fs/binfmt_aout.c
    @@ -278,6 +278,12 @@ static int load_aout_binary(struct linux
    return -ENOEXEC;
    }

    + /* Requires a mmap handler. This prevents people from using a.out
    + * as part of an exploit attack against /proc-related vulnerabilities.
    + */
    + if (!bprm->file->f_op || !bprm->file->f_op->mmap)
    + return -ENOEXEC;
    +
    fd_offset = N_TXTOFF(ex);

    /* Check initial limits. This avoids letting people circumvent
    @@ -476,6 +482,12 @@ static int load_aout_library(struct file
    goto out;
    }

    + /* Requires a mmap handler. This prevents people from using a.out
    + * as part of an exploit attack against /proc-related vulnerabilities.
    + */
    + if (!file->f_op || !file->f_op->mmap)
    + goto out;
    +
    if (N_FLAGS(ex))
    goto out;
